San Bernardino shooter Syed Rizwan Farook had contact with people from at least two terror organizations overseas, including the Nusra Front in Syria and al-Shabab in Somalia, a federal law enforcement official said Friday.

The revelations came as the FBI formally announced they were investigating the shooting spree as an act of terrorism.

Farook and his wife, Tashfeen Malik, died in a police shootout on Wednesday several hours after bursting into a holiday potluck for the San Bernardino County health department and killing 14 people.

As the investigation expands, the law enforcement source said, agents are trying to learn more about the couple’s contacts here and overseas, “especially those in Pakistan” where Farook visited and Malik was born. One key question, said the official, “is if they had any weapons or terror training in Pakistan.” The sources described "some kind" of contact between Farook and people from the Nusra Front and al-Shababa. It's unclear what type of contact or with whom....
